Chapter 457: Chapter 389: A Twist of Fate

Jia Yu displayed a cunning fox-like smile:

"It’s a small matter, I visit Red Flame Peak every few months."

If I visit your territory, your disciples have to entertain me, right?

"Haha, feel free to visit. I’ve already instructed the disciples that as long as Senior Brother comes to Red Flame Peak, there will definitely be Spirit Wine gifted."

Ji An laughed, saying that in a few years, Li Haoran will come to Red Flame Peak for Qi Eating. With the help of all the senior and junior brothers, his Dao Field should be very stable.

"Hearing this makes me feel a bit embarrassed."

Jia Yu smiled with satisfaction, "Junior Brother, the ancestor should have told you about the situation in the Southern Continent. Let me add one more word.

The cultivators of the Shadowless Sect are extremely vicious. If you become enemies, you must eradicate them and swiftly move on...

I suspect they target foreign cultivators, torturing them till they die with resentment, thereby gathering Evil Ghosts.

The Shadowless Sect’s territory is in the Black Mist Mountain Range. You must not go near there."

He recounted his experiences traveling the Southern Continent and sternly warned.

Ji An furrowed his brow, "Such behavior, how is it different from demon cultivators? How can the cultivators of the Southern Continent tolerate them?"

Using living people as materials is exactly like the conduct of demon cultivators. How could such a force not have enemies?

"The Shadowless Sect is a Nascent Soul Sect. Unless caught in the act by forces of the same level, who dares to provoke them?"

Jia Yu snorted coldly and then sighed helplessly, "Even if discovered, as long as they don’t enrage everyone, at most they’ll punish some low-level lackeys.

The real offenders still roam free.

The world is neither black nor white but a gray where black and white are indistinguishable.

Junior Brother, don’t let your sense of justice overflow when you go traveling."

Ji An gave a deep, quiet nod; he was now just a junior cultivator at the Chao Origin Stage. What use was a towering sense of justice?

The scene suddenly fell silent, and Jia Yu suddenly laughed heartily, saying:

"Did I talk too much about dark things and affect Junior Brother’s mindset?

No matter what happens, the sun will rise every day, and even the most turbid river will have a day when its mud and sand settle and it clears."

He was suddenly somewhat worried about this junior brother, who had always stayed within the sect and had no disputes with others, unaware of the dangers outside.

"Senior Brother, it won’t be so."

Ji An smiled and shook his head. In the past life, without personal power and with the rapid spread of information, though he hadn’t personally witnessed bizarre things, he had heard many through word of mouth.

Where there is light, there is darkness. Where there is yin, there is yang. Influence mindset? It doesn’t exist.

There’s a simple and straightforward truth: all helplessness is due to insufficient power.

The two chatted leisurely for a while longer, and Jia Yu took leave, saying:

"There’s nothing left here, so I’ll return to the sect now.

I must say, having a Teleportation Array is truly convenient.

Junior Brother, until we meet again."

Seeing off Senior Brother, Ji An sat down cross-legged, placing the Jade Slip of the Silk Thread Spell on his forehead, reading the information within.

Puppets only have basic ’programming’ and can fight instinctively, but to fully utilize their function, Divine Sense control is needed.

Without a secret technique, being able to multitask is already impressive for a cultivator, like casting spells while controlling a puppet for assistance, but they can only manage one puppet.

Now, with the Silk Thread Spell, multi-thread synchronization is possible, which is why the Golden Puppet Sect is so powerful.

Some say that certain cultivators in the Golden Puppet Sect can control dozens of puppets simultaneously, coordinating them neatly for full-scale, all-angle saturation attacks.

In Ji An’s eyes, such cultivators are the ’pay-to-win’ players of the Cultivation Realm.

Creating puppets also requires materials, and the higher the tier of the puppet, the higher the material’s quality must be.

He repeatedly studied the spell of the Silk Thread Spell seven or eight times, ensuring he fully understood the meaning before calming his mind and sensing the power of Divine Sense.

At this moment, his Divine Sense could be large or small, able to condense into a beam or scatter like a cloud, but no matter its transformation, it was a whole.

It is said that some secret techniques can condense thought into a blade to cut one’s own Divine Sense, allowing a strand to be separated for multi-tasking.

Whether such a secret technique could succeed is one thing, but the intense pain from self-severing Divine Sense is not something ordinary cultivators can bear.

Constant damage to Divine Sense will harm the Spirit Soul, and a wounded Spirit Soul cannot be nurtured back with Spirit Tea or Soul Incense.

Three-tier Soul Nourishing Wood is required for long-term nurturing to repair the Spirit Soul’s damage.

If the damage is too severe, there’s even a risk of becoming an idiot.

This Silk Thread Spell secret technique is much gentler; it uses secret techniques for direct separation.

Ji An didn’t realize this secret technique was mastered at the Qi Refining Stage in the Golden Puppet Sect; he only found it simple.

In just a moment, he successfully released it, briefly separating a strand of Divine Sense.

[Magic Technique: Silk Thread Spell (Entry 1%)]

This was much simpler than practicing Spirit Roar, Ji An thought smugly to himself.

He continued to practice the secret technique repeatedly, with increasing success rate and duration.

By midnight, feeling his Spirit Soul growing weary, he ended his cultivation, connecting his mind with the Upper Stone Turtle.

[Magic Technique: Silk Thread Spell (Entry 36%)]

"Not bad!"

Ji An praised himself. In less than three double hours, he improved by over 9% each double hour. In a few days, the secret technique would be mastered.

Now he could easily separate a strand of Divine Sense, maintaining it for one breath, about four or five seconds, which was already sufficient for battle needs.

"Refine the Spiritual Mechanism and enhance the Silk Thread Spell!"

Ji An tentatively gave the order, receiving a response that it couldn’t be enhanced, as expected.

He took out the Wind Furnace and Spiritual Charcoal, boiled some hot water, and brewed a cup of Cloud Peak Silver Needle Tea.

This time, he wasn’t as extravagant as usual, only pinching four threads of tea leaves. Once he leaves the sect, the tea leaves won’t be replenished.

...

Golden Puppet Pavilion, fourth floor.

Various stewards gathered together to tally the day’s earnings and store the spirit stones and various spiritual materials.

Fang Shiping glanced around at everyone, chuckling as he said:

"Today, in the area I was responsible for, we sold one Tier Two Top-Grade Puppet Storm Thunder Eagle and one Tier Two Upper Grade Puppet Black Ape, earning a total of eighty-two top-grade spirit stones and some top-grade Canglan Dragon Wood.

These Canglan Dragon Woods are worth thirty top-grade spirit stones, but their real value is at least thirty-six spirit stones."

As he spoke, he took the spirit wood out of the Grotto Void Stone, feeling quite pleased:

"These two pieces of spirit wood have remnants of the dragon’s aura!"

"Old Fang’s had a stroke of luck, damn it!"

Immediately, a colleague called out sourly. The remnants of the dragon’s aura are extremely rare, even in the Central Continent, and only the Divine Wood Sect can steadily cultivate such spirit wood.

Yun Feihua, a late-stage Golden Core cultivator, was in charge of the Golden Puppet Pavilion’s traveling merchant venture this time.

He smiled and said, "Not bad."

Traveling in the Western Continent, being able to acquire high-quality Tier Two Top-Grade Materials is a good harvest.

He probed the spirit wood with his divine sense and then stimulated it with a secret technique.

The grand dragon’s roar bellowed in his sea of consciousness, his expression slightly surprised, as he said earnestly:

"Shiping, your estimate is conservative. The value of these two pieces of spiritual materials should be forty top-grade spirit stones."

Even for a Divine Wood Sect cultivator, cultivating Canglan Dragon Wood with such abundant spiritual nature still requires fortune.

"Old Fang, you need to treat us!"

Fang Shiping’s face lit up with joy; he could receive more reward.

Yun Feihua carefully examined the two pieces of spiritual materials, speaking in a deep voice:

"Who was the cultivator trading the Canglan Dragon Wood? Can you still contact them?"

He wanted to figure out where they got the spirit wood, as Canglan Dragon Wood is planted in many continents, the region where spirit wood can develop such strong spiritual properties must have some mystique.

Western Continent cultivators probably would not have such insight; if the location where the spirit wood was obtained could be found, perhaps there’s an extra fortune to be had.

This is the benefit of broad experience; cultivators with shallow knowledge, even if they get a treasure, would only discard it as a mundane item.

Fang Shiping understood the hidden meaning in his elder’s words and quickly said:

"The cultivator who brought out the Canglan Dragon Wood is named Ji An, a Golden Spirit Sect cultivator. We should be able to contact him.

Master, shall I send someone to the Golden Spirit Sect’s station in the marketplace to inquire tomorrow?"

Cyan Cloud Immortal City is the largest immortal city in the Western Province, but compared to many large marketplaces in the Central Continent, it’s not large enough to qualify as an immortal city.

Yun Feihua nodded slightly, and said indifferently:

"Don’t go too early; it will seem too impatient. Invite them over as a guest again, then subtly find out where the spirit wood was obtained."

In his subconscious mind, he couldn’t imagine that there could be a cultivator in the Western Province capable of cultivating Canglan Dragon Wood to such an extent.

"As you command, the disciple will definitely complete the task perfectly."

Fang Shiping laughed. Being subtle was his forte.

"Hmm, if there are additional findings, there will be merit for you."

...

The next day, late morning.

Steward Liu arrived at Cyan Cloud Immortal City and found the Golden Spirit Sect’s station.

He found the cultivator in charge there and revealed the Golden Puppet Pavilion’s token, smiling kindly:

"I am Liu Anqing, acting as a steward of the Golden Puppet Pavilion from the Central Continent, and I have been instructed by our steward Fang to invite Elder Ji An of your sect to the Golden Puppet Pavilion for a talk."

"I am Zhang Ping. Steward Liu, your timing is unfortunate. Junior Martial Uncle Ji left an hour ago."

"Elder Ji has returned to the sect? Fellow Daoist, could you send a message?

To be honest, Elder Ji purchased a puppet from our shop yesterday, and there was a misunderstanding. Our steward wishes to apologize to Elder Ji in person."

He said this while taking out a middle-grade spirit stone and handing it to Zhang Ping.

Zhang Ping squeezed the spirit stone, and said with difficulty:

"Sending a message is a small matter, but Junior Martial Uncle Ji hasn’t returned to the sect. He’s on a journey outside the sect and it’s unknown when he’ll return."

The opposite party’s enthusiasm and generosity made it embarrassing for him not to accept it.

However, yesterday he heard Junior Martial Uncle Jia mention that Junior Martial Uncles Ji An and Han Yan would be traveling together.

"Ah? Such a coincidence!"

Liu Anqing was a bit suspicious, but there was no reason for them to lie, not to mention, they had accepted his spirit stone, and taking someone’s property makes the hand short!

He was a bit dumbfounded, not knowing what to do for a moment.

"It’s quite a coincidence."

Zhang Ping offered the spirit stone back, saying:

"I couldn’t help Fellow Daoist Liu, I feel guilty keeping this spirit stone."

This was a tactic to retreat in order to advance, making it awkward for the other party to take it back.

Liu Anqing forced a smile, pushing the other’s hand back:

"Fellow Daoist, use it for tea. The steward is still waiting for my news, I must take my leave."

What a mess!
